How Do I Log In to the 3JTech Dedicated Wifi Router (DWR) Router Admin Panel?
To access the 3JTech Dedicated Wifi Router (DWR) admin panel (router configuration interface), follow these steps:- Connect your computer to the 3JTech Dedicated Wifi Router (DWR) either via an Ethernet cable or through its Wi-Fi network. It is recommended to use a wired connection to prevent any interruption during the configuration process.
- Open a web browser of your choice (such as Chrome, Firefox, Edge, or Safari) on the connected device.
- In the address bar of the web browser, type the default IP address of the router, which is 192.168.8.1, and press Enter.
- You will be presented with a login screen. Enter the default username "cameras" and the default password "cameras" into the respective fields.
- Click the "Login" or "Admin" button to access the router's administrative interface.
How Do I Find the 3JTech Dedicated Wifi Router (DWR) Login IP Address?
The default IP address for the 3JTech Dedicated Wifi Router (DWR) is 192.168.8.1. This address serves as the gateway to your router's administrative settings. If you are unsure of your router's IP address, you can typically find it printed on a label on the back or bottom of the router itself. If the default IP address does not work, your network may be configured with a different IP address. To confirm the IP address your device is using to communicate with the router, you can use your computer's command prompt or terminal. On Windows, open Command Prompt and typeipconfig, then look for the "Default Gateway" address. On macOS or Linux, open Terminal and type ip route | grep default or netstat -rn | grep default, and the displayed address will be your router's IP.
How Do I Reset the 3JTech Dedicated Wifi Router (DWR) Router Password Without Logging In?
You can reset the 3JTech Dedicated Wifi Router (DWR) to factory defaults without knowing the current password by using the hardware reset button. This process will revert all settings, including the Wi-Fi password and any custom configurations, back to their original state.- Locate the small reset button on your 3JTech Dedicated Wifi Router (DWR). It is usually a small, recessed button on the back or bottom of the router case.
- While the router is powered on, use a paperclip or a similar pointed object to press and hold this reset button for approximately 10 seconds.
- Release the button. The router will restart and return to its factory default settings.
- After the router has rebooted, you can log in using the default IP address (192.168.8.1), username ("cameras"), and password ("cameras").

Securing your 3JTech Dedicated Wifi Router (DWR) after logging in is a critical step to protect your network from unauthorized access. First, it is highly recommended to change the default username and password immediately. Choose a strong, unique password that is difficult to guess, combining u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ols. Enable WPA2 or WPA3 encryption for your Wi-Fi network to ensure secure wireless communication. Disabling remote management, which allows access to the router's settings from outside your local network, is also a vital security measure unless specifically needed. Regularly check for and install firmware updates from the manufacturer, as these often contain important security patches.
